MylesC is right, the Vic school issue is complicated. The province originally announced grand plans to turn it into Juliard North, then cut the funding when revenue temporarily tumbled in 2002.
I don't know what's happened since, but I'd venture a guess that school board and provincial priorities got shuffled, leaving Vic behind. Which is a damn freakin' shame, if you ask me. On express buses, the city's transit department unveiled great plans for an express system with dedicated lanes, but it was sandbagged by NIMBY concerns.
